Biography of Richard Bulkeley 1533-1621

Paternal Family Tree: Bulkeley

In or before 1533 [his father] Richard Bulkeley and [his mother] Margaret Savage (age 10) were married. They were fifth cousin once removed.

In 1533 Richard Bulkeley was born to Richard Bulkeley and Margaret Savage (age 11).

Before 1572 [his father] Richard Bulkeley and Agnes Needham were married.

Around 1572 [his father] Richard Bulkeley died.

Before 21st October 1573 Richard Bulkeley (age 40) and Katherine Davenport were married.

On 21st October 1573 [his wife] Katherine Davenport died.

In 1576 Richard Bulkeley (age 43) was knighted at Whitehall Palace [Map].

On 18th February 1576 Richard Bulkeley (age 43) and Mary Burgh were married.

Before 10th August 1585 [his son] Thomas Bulkeley 1st Viscount Bulkeley was born to Richard Bulkeley (age 52) and [his wife] Mary Burgh. On 10th August 1585 Thomas Bulkeley 1st Viscount Bulkeley was baptised.

In 1614 [his son-in-law] Edwin Sandys (age 23) and [his daughter] Penelope Bulkeley were married. They were half sixth cousins.

In 1618 Richard Bulkeley (age 85) built at Baron Hill, Beaumaris.

Before 28th June 1621 [his son] Richard Bulkeley died.

On 28th June 1621 Richard Bulkeley (age 88) died at Beaumaris, Anglesey. He was buried at Beaumaris, Anglesey.

After 1638 [his former wife] Mary Burgh died.
